Tyler Manion is the Lowcountry reporter for WTOC. He joined the team in June of 2021, shortly after graduating from Arizona State University.
Before finishing college Tyler covered events like the 2020 election, the women’s triathlon national championships, and everything in between. He was even awarded the Broadcast Education Association’s award for best collegiate television news anchor and placed second in the Hearst TV News Competition.
Although he grew up in the Philadelphia area, Tyler has been visiting Hilton Head Island every year since he was four months old and has loved the Lowcountry his whole life.
